Foldable treadmills are an ideal option for those looking to exercise at home, but don't have much space. When not in use they can be folded up and stored in a corner of the room or a closet. They are cheaper than non-folding models and can be purchased for less than a hundred dollars. When choosing a treadmill that can fold it is essential to look at the features that will best meet your fitness goals. For example certain treadmills are suitable for walking, whereas others are suitable for running. Be aware of the maximum speed as well as the incline that the treadmill is able to handle.

The ease of assembly and transport is a further factor to think about. Some models require two people to unfold and lift, while other models feature a multi-link design that makes it simpler to move. In addition, some folding treadmills are made to be carried in the trunk of a car making them an ideal option for those who lead busy lifestyles.

Examine the specifications of the treadmill and read reviews online prior to purchasing. Consider the maximum user weight and running belt dimensions. Also, consider the maximum speed as well as the incline and warranty. Also, you should consider the maximum load and power of the motor. Based on your needs, you may want to choose a foldable treadmill with incline for running, power walking or both. You should also consider the motor size and type. If you plan to power walk or jog occasionally, a motor of 2.0-2.5 hp is sufficient. If you're a runner you should choose a treadmill with a higher horsepower. Certain models include additional features like a device holder or dual cooling fans. Other models have more advanced features, like touchscreen displays that allow you to program the treadmill.

Another consideration is how easy the treadmill can be assembled. Some models require at least two people to fold or unfold them, which could be a challenge when there isn't any assistance available. Certain models come with an hydraulic rod that makes folding and unfolding the treadmill simple and safe.
